本文为iOS软件高级开发爱好者们带来一些学习自流井iOS软件高级开发技巧的实用建议,帮助读者们打造精品APP。文章主要包括五个部分,分别为:1、为什么需要学习自流井iOS软件高级开发技巧;2、自流井iOS软件高级开发技巧的基础学习路径;3、自流井iOS软件高级开发中常见的技巧和技术;4、精品APP的设计要点与实现方法;5、结尾。
1. 为什么需要学习自流井iOS软件高级开发技巧
随着移动设备的普及,iOS应用开发已经成为一个通用且高需求的领域。要在市场上成功推出并维护一个iOS应用,需要有深厚的技术功底和对用户需求的敏锐洞察力,特别是需要对iOS架构和Apple开发工具的使用非常熟悉。学习自流井iOS软件高级开发技巧可以帮助你更好地掌握开发技术,运用最新的技术开发出更优秀的APP。
2. 自流井iOS软件高级开发技巧的基础学习路径
为了学习自流井iOS软件高级开发技巧,首先需要学习基础的iOS开发技术和语言,如Objective-C和Swift等。在此基础上,你可以学习Core Data、网络编程、自定义UI、Autolayout、代码优化等高端技术。要想成为一名资深的iOS软件开发人员,必须熟悉Apple设计和开发工具的使用,如Xcode、Instruments、Interface Builder和Apple代码标准等。
3. 自流井iOS软件高级开发中常见的技巧和技术
在自流井iOS软件高级开发中,下面一些常见的技巧和技术将对你有所启发,包括:使用NSDataDetector解析来自网页或电话的数据、使用NSURLSession进行Web服务、为触摸事件添加GCD任务、创建自定义动画过渡、使用Swift和RxSwift进行响应式编程、使用Core Data进行本地数据存储和检索。
4. 精品APP的设计要点与实现方法
一般不同于常规应用,精品APP需要更多地重视UI设计和用户交互,因为这些因素往往决定了用户是否安装和使用该应用。以下是几个设计要点:简单易用、高效快捷的UI、良好的用户体验、多任务处理、简洁明了的菜单和导航栏、自定义视图和控制器、本地化、前后端优化等。要实现它们,我们需要了解相关技术,使用最新和最佳的开发工具和库,例如设计工具Sketch、自动布局工具Autolayout以及CocoaPods等。
自流井iOS软件高级开发技巧的学习会为你提供灵感和技术支持,帮助你开发一个精品APP。本文整理了一些学习路径、技巧和最佳实践,希望对iOS开发爱好者们有所帮助。通过学习和实践,你可以掌握开发所需的技能,并提高 iOS 应用的质量。
本文介绍了学习自流井iOS软件高级开发技巧的意义和好处,以及如何使用这些技巧来打造精品APP。文章从前置知识、基础技能、进阶技巧、实战案例和总结五个方面进行了分析和讲解,旨在帮助读者深入了解iOS开发技能的精髓和实现方法。
1. 前置知识:了解iOS开发基础
在学习iOS软件高级开发技巧之前,首先需要掌握iOS开发的基础知识。这包括Xcode、Swift语言、iOS SDK、UI和UX设计等方面。只有在熟练掌握这些基础知识后,才能更好地理解和应用高级技巧。本文介绍了如何以系统化和科学化的方式来学习这些基础知识,并提供了相关资源和工具供读者参考。
2. 基础技能:掌握核心功能和技巧
除了掌握基础知识外,还需要熟练掌握一些核心功能和技巧,以便快速实现和调试应用程序。这包括网络操作、多媒体处理、数据存储、界面布局和响应等方面。本文介绍了这些基础技能的实现方法和注意事项,让读者在实践中更好地掌握这些技能。
3. 进阶技巧:探索iOS开发的深度和广度
随着iOS应用市场的不断扩大和技术的不断进步,开发者需要不断拓展自己的技能和视野。本文介绍了一些进阶技巧,例如自定义控件、高级动画、多线程处理、内存优化和安全保障等方面。这些技巧可以帮助读者更好地实现创新的功能和体验,并提高应用程序的质量和性能。
4. 实战案例:应用技巧于实践
理论知识和技巧只有应用于实践中才能真正发挥其价值。本文介绍了一些实战案例,分别从游戏开发、社交应用、金融应用、医疗健康等领域的典型案例中提取出技术和设计的要点。这些案例可以帮助读者学习并扩展自己的创造力和实践经验。
5. 总结:追求卓越,创造价值
本文旨在帮助读者掌握高级iOS开发技能,从而打造出快速、安全、可靠、美观、易用的精品应用程序。在学习和实践中,读者需要不断追求卓越和创造价值,不断拓展自己的技能和思维,为用户带来更好的体验和价值。